<blockquote data-quote="Tnwhip" data-source="post: 997923" data-attributes="member: 32195"><p>He didn't mention calling He told me they hear elk bugling in the timber and stalked to the sound. Closing the distance to 70 yards. Picking out pieces of elk through the trees. They passed several in the 330 class that were running back and forth, chaseing cows trying to avoid the herd bull. They got to him just before the light got to dim to see the sights. He said 10 seconds LOL. After the shot the bull ran 30 yards. It was a heart shot. I will try and find the picture of the heart.</p></blockquote><p></p>
